Experience 

Staci Cornwell is a Licensed Mental Health Clinician and certified Child and Geriatric Mental Health Specialist with over 25 years of hands-on experience supporting individuals in crisis from youth to older adults. As the founder of STACIA LLC, Staci brings a fresh, hopeful perspective to some of our most difficult topics and is known for her dynamic speaking style, humor, and ability to turn complex challenges into actionable insight. Her passion lies in changing the conversation around suicide prevention by focusing on upstream, connection-based approaches, and emphasizing resilience as a core prevention tool. She is a trusted expert in the field, and the author of The Five Spirals of Resilience. Her message resonates across industries because it’s rooted in something everyone needs: connection.

Affiliations

Staci is the founder and CEO of STACIA LLC, Specialized Training and Consultation (an NBCC Approved Continuing Education Provider -ACEP No. 7801), the Mental Health Coordinator for a local school district, and serves as Chair of Prevent Suicide Spokane Coalition. She is an active member of ATAP, IMPACT, and other community coalitions, collaborating closely with schools, first responders, nonprofits, and other partners to build a more connected, resilient community. Her passion lies in equipping others with the tools to support those in need before a crisis begins.  She is always seeking opportunities for creative and innovative projects/partnerships that aim to support those in need.

About

Staci's approach to behavioral health is to build resilience in our youth, families, and community so we all can effectively manage the stressors life may bring and be able to successfully navigate through dark times in hopes of not venturing into a crisis situation, but if we do, we are equipped to move beyond it safely. Her intent is to impact individuals before a concern develops and equip others with the knowledge and skills to elevate their support to a resilient community. Through her unique blend of professional expertise, real-world experience, and heartfelt storytelling, Staci aims to empower communities, inspire collaboration, and help people everywhere feel more connected, supported, and prepared to make a difference.
